So I have been slowly working up a load for my 257 wby vanguard s2 using IMR 7828 and barnes 100 grn ttsx. Just wondering if anyone else has used this combination and what they have found to be maximum load. I started at 70.5 grns and slowly (6 test batches) worked my way up to 72.8 which I found very accurate in testing. It is a hot load, cci primers slightly flattened, some butt polishing on brass...bolt lifts no tighter than the rounds chamber (a little stiff, but not bad).
I am also waiting for a reply from barnes on this as I did not find exact load data for this combination, maybe should have emailed before I began loading?? Working off a combination of data with minimums around 70 grains, and maximums at 72-73 grains...
